![]() |
|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#1 |
Форумчанин
Регистрация: 10.02.2021
Сообщений: 653
|
![]()
Задача такая:
Программа А запускает программу B, передаёт в нее строку и переходит в режим ожидания Программа В принимает строку, совершает обработку и передаёт ее обратно в А, после чего закрывается Программа А "оживает" после закрытия программы В |
![]() |
![]() |
![]() |
#2 |
Старожил
Регистрация: 15.02.2010
Сообщений: 15,732
|
![]()
Заполняете TStartupInfo, вызваете и читайте/пишите.
|
![]() |
![]() |
![]() |
#3 |
Форумчанин
Регистрация: 17.06.2012
Сообщений: 965
|
![]()
Строка сохраняется на диск и считывается
Совет прошлого века
Случайные и Массивы https://programmersforum.ru/showthread.php?t=344371 Учим C# & basic & excel & python https://programmersforum.ru/showthre...=327446&page=5 ничего нерекомендую
|
![]() |
![]() |
![]() |
#4 |
Старожил
Регистрация: 15.02.2010
Сообщений: 15,732
|
![]()
сфинкс, это особенно актуально, если эточужая консольная программа...
|
![]() |
![]() |
![]() |
#5 | ||
ПШП
Участник клуба
Регистрация: 15.07.2013
Сообщений: 1,894
|
![]() Цитата:
Режим ожидания тоже элементарно. Если программу не закрывать. Цитата:
Kronos913, вы на форуме не первый день. Может сформулируете нормальный вопрос не про сферического коня в вакууме? |
||
![]() |
![]() |
![]() |
#6 | |
Старожил
Регистрация: 15.02.2010
Сообщений: 15,732
|
![]()
А если это чужая консольная программа?
Причем тут "если"? Цитата:
А что вам не нравится в вопросе? Ответ дан во 2 посте темы, перенаправляете стандартные ввод/вывод и работаете. |
|
![]() |
![]() |
![]() |
#7 |
Высокая репутация
СуперМодератор
Регистрация: 27.07.2008
Сообщений: 15,604
|
![]()
Функция для запуска приложения с параметрами, ожидания его завершения и получения кода возврата:
Код:
Код:
E-Mail: arigato.freelance@gmail.com
|
![]() |
![]() |
![]() |
#8 |
Форумчанин
Регистрация: 10.02.2021
Сообщений: 653
|
![]() |
![]() |
![]() |
![]() |
#9 |
Форумчанин
Регистрация: 10.02.2021
Сообщений: 653
|
![]() |
![]() |
![]() |
![]() |
#10 |
Форумчанин
Регистрация: 10.02.2021
Сообщений: 653
|
![]()
Arigato как я понял, то функция самого вызова, верно?
Тогда второй вопрос - как из программы В вернуть какую-то информацию? |
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
C++, передача значения строки между функциями | denkorg | Общие вопросы C/C++ | 2 | 17.12.2017 09:52 |
Выбор между программами | Karfagen | Свободное общение | 4 | 02.03.2017 13:58 |
обмен данными между программами | nestor_petrovitch | Общие вопросы Delphi | 3 | 05.02.2012 20:56 |
как реализовать обмен данными между программами | Андрей.12 | Работа с сетью в Delphi | 1 | 26.11.2009 08:06 |
Обмен данными между двуми программами | JRK_DV | Помощь студентам | 6 | 28.11.2008 00:18 |